The Role of Appetite Suppressants
One of the most common types of weight loss supplements is appetite suppressants. These supplements are designed to reduce hunger, making it easier for you to stick to your calorie goals. Ingredients such as Garcinia Cambogia, glucomannan, and green tea extract have been shown to have appetite-suppressing properties. By helping you feel fuller for longer, appetite suppressants can reduce the tendency to snack and overeat, ultimately contributing to weight loss.
Fat Burners: A Metabolism Boost
Fat burners are another popular category of weight loss supplements. These products are formulated with ingredients that can increase your metabolism, which is the rate at which your body burns calories. Caffeine, green tea extract, and CLA (Conjugated Linoleic Acid) are commonly found in fat-burning supplements. These ingredients can help you burn more calories throughout the day, even while at rest. A faster metabolism means your body can process food and burn fat more efficiently, which may lead to weight loss over time.
Thermogenics: Heating Your Calorie Burn
Thermogenic supplements are a subset of fat burners that work by increasing your body temperature, which in turn helps you burn more calories. They contain ingredients like caffeine, capsaicin (found in chili peppers), and synephrine. The idea is that by raising your body temperature slightly, your body works harder to cool down, leading to an increase in calorie expenditure. These thermogenic effects are believed to enhance fat loss during both exercise and rest.
The Importance of Quality and Safety
Quality and safety of supplements should always be top priorities. The supplement industry is largely unregulated, meaning some products make exaggerated claims or contain harmful ingredients. It’s crucial to do your research before purchasing any supplement. Look for brands that are transparent about their ingredient list and have third-party testing to ensure purity and potency. Additionally, cons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new supplement regimen, especially if you have underlying health conditions or take other medications.
